Saligao is visible from cyberspace, however the photos are much more grainy(compared to Mapusa – most probably due to altitude)
The church is visible also at: Latitude 15°32'46.75"N and Longitude 73°47'9.93"E
In fact if you follow the road from Charas building to the cemetery, you can see the dhobi's washing which shows as a big patch of white (unless some big building has been constructed in the fields in the last three years since I was in Goa)
The saligao fountain is a dense patch of green in front of the seminary which is located at 15°32'16.27"N; 73°47'48.64"E
One should be able display the latitude and longitude by pressing Ctrl+L (Tip: Locate a known area and navigate from there using roads to keep your bearings) I actually located the Gandhi Chowk in Mapusa and followed the road right back to Saligao.
